You’re Not Doing Wellness Wrong — Escaping the All-or-Nothing Trap

from Wellness Blueprints: Nourish Your Roots with Jess · host Jessica Milner

What if the problem isn’t you—it’s the pressure to pick a side?  In this episode, I will talk about the toxic “all-or-nothing” mindset that so many women face when it comes to wellness, nutrition, parenting, and just being human. Whether it’s being shamed for seeing a conventional doctor, judged for letting your kids eat ice cream 🍦, or feeling stuck in rigid health “rules” that leave you exhausted and overwhelmed… this conversation is your permission slip to stop fighting yourself. You’ll learn: Why “perfect wellness” is a trap keeping you stuck in shame + guilt How extreme thinking hijacks your nervous system & energy centers Simple, gentle shifts to reclaim balance without burning out Why growth only happens when you allow space for nuance It’s time to drop the labels, stop the judgment, and find your version of balance — one that actually feels nourishing for your mind, body, and soul.
